Detailed introduction of the instrument
Automatically implement core functions such as extraction, rinsing, and solvent recovery, making it easy to conduct experiments
• Achieve full process hot soaking extraction, with dual heating of the collection bottle and extraction chamber, resulting in fast extraction speed and a 20% -80% reduction in extraction time compared to traditional Soxhlet extraction method
The true national standard Soxhlet extraction method has real and reliable experimental data (the semi-automatic fat analyzer on the market is not Soxhlet extraction method, only hot soaking and rinsing).
• Supports various extraction methods such as Soxhlet thermal extraction, classical Soxhlet extraction, thermal extraction, continuous extraction, etc., with complete functions, it is a good helper for organic chemistry experiments
Based on the principle of leverage, the extraction chamber compression mechanism has high reliability, leakage prevention, and safety assurance (in response to the problem of motor compression in automatic fat meters on the market)
PTFE tubing, comparable to non conventional fluororubber tubing and silicone tubing
The extraction process can be paused and resumed at any time, with flexible operation
Heating method: Metal bath heating method, faster heating and more stable temperature
Anti corrosion design: using PTFE valve core, imported organic solvent resistant pipes, and anti-corrosion treatment for key parts
• Safety features: equipped with functions such as condensate monitoring, leakage monitoring, and temperature anomaly monitoring
• Operation mode: External controller, large screen display
Extraction program: Fully automatic program control, capable of saving 10 extraction programs
Batch processing capacity: 3 pieces/batch (6 pieces/batch optional)
Sample size: 0.5g~15g
